An independent (financial adviser’s) view

So what will Boris’s negotiating priorities be in the trade deal Liam Fox (kids etc.) said could be negotiated by tea time. Fishing? 0.1% of GDP. Farming? 0.63%. Hospitality? 4% Financial services? 7%. 

So if head rules over heart, all those Brexit-voting fishermen will be very disappointed. But if head ruled heart, we wouldn’t be doing this in the first place. Bankers beware.
